Runway Capability
At 4250 feet, Quantico Marine Corps Airfield / Turner Field serves light jets and turboprops. The Citation CJ series, Phenom 100, HondaJet, and King Air family operate within this runway capability. Midsize jets require careful performance analysis based on temperature and aircraft weight. Pilots should reference aircraft-specific takeoff and landing distance charts for KNYG's runway length and 10 ft MSL elevation.
Charter Considerations
When chartering from Quantico Marine Corps Airfield / Turner Field, consider the round-trip economics. One-way charters incur a repositioning fee (the empty leg back to base). Round-trips from KNYG eliminate this cost. For one-way flights, The Jet Finder checks for aircraft that need to reposition through Quantico anyway, reducing or eliminating the empty-leg premium.
